Induction of Endogenous Insulin-Like Growth Factor-I Secretion Alters the Hypothalamic-Pituitary-Testicular Function in Growth Hormone-Deficient Adult Dwarf Mice1

Abstract: To evaluate the influence of growth hormone (GH) on hypothalamic-pituitary-testicular function, GH-deficient adult male Ames dwarf mice were treated (s.c.) twice daily for 8 days with either vehicle or bovine GH (25 micrograms/injection/mouse). Normal male siblings treated with vehicle served as controls. Two in vivo experiments were conducted. In experiment 1, on Day 8, mice were treated (i.p.) with either saline or LHRH (1 ng/g b.w.) in saline. Fifteen minutes later, blood was obtained via heart puncture to … Show more

“…Although IGF-I increases LH secretion in peri-pubertal, intact rats (Hiney et al 1996), studies have not examined specifically how IGF-I may modify gonadal steroid negative feedback at first ovulation in this species. However, GH deficiency enhances testosterone negative feedback inhibition of LH secretion in adult mice, an effect reversed by the administration of GH and the resulting increase in IGF-I (Chandrashekar & Bartke 1993). Taken together, these data suggest that the post-menarchial increase in GH-dependent IGF-I concentrations sets the tempo for the later stages of puberty, determining the occurrence of first ovulation in monkeys.…”

“…In Laron-syndrome patients treated with high concentrations of exogenous IGF-I, levels of sex-steroid hormones have been shown to increase and some female patients developed hyperadrogenism with oligo/amenorrhoea and acne (59,60). There is also in vitro evidence that IGF-I enhances the LH-dependent ovarian (33,61,62) and adrenal (63,64) androgen production and that IGF-I might affect gonadotropin production at the pituitary level (65,66).…”
